We are looking for a Senior Technical Program Manager (TPM) to build internal tools for Amazon Ads' services organization. Come join Advertising Services to deliver the unified surfaces, proactive signals, and workflow integrations that enable our teams to manage advertising customer relationships and campaigns at scale - faster, smarter, and with greater visibility than ever before.

Our service teams own customer value realization for the world's largest advertisers across every media type within Amazon Ads. As we scale, we are investing in the internal tools and integrations that allow these teams to operate more effectively - putting the right information in front of the right person at the right time, connecting the communication channels our teams already use, and enabling proactive customer management. You will own a portfolio of initiatives across this space, partnering with engineering, Salesforce developer teams, and service team leaders to deliver.

Key job responsibilities

From problem definition through launch and adoption, you own the "what," the "when," and the "how well" for your portfolio. You will:
• Define product requirements by working backwards from service team needs and advertising customer outcomes
• Create, manage and communicate project plans for multiple programs
• Translate technical and business requirements into backlog stories
• Establish and manage towards meaningful goals and milestones
• Partner with engineering to deliver integrations, automation, and unified surfaces
• Lead goals and milestones with our developers and builders on implementation
• Own adoption metrics, feedback, and iterate post-launch
• Make trade-off decisions between speed and scope, managing expectations with senior stakeholders
• Facilitate team's agile practice to ensure on time delivery

Audible is a provider of spoken audio information and entertainment , on the Internet. They provide premium spoken audio content, such as audio versions of books and newspapers and radio programs, that is delivered over the Internet and played back on personal computers and hand-held electronic devices. The Audible service allows consumers to purchase and download their content from their Website, store it in digital files and play it back on personal computers and electronic devices. More than 15,000 hours of audio content are available on their Web site, including audio versions of books, periodicals and radio programs. Several manufacturers have agreed to support and promote the playback of their content on their hand-held audio-enabled electronic devices.
